Going to therapy is a big step. If you consider yourself a private person or don’t like talking about yourself, opening up in therapy can be hard. Regardless of if you’re brand new or have been going for a long time, you may feel overwhelmed at the possibility of sharing your pain and deepest secrets with a stranger. This is perfectly normal, and many people find themselves in this position.
